Abstract
The utility model discloses a Li-ion battery cover plate comprising a plate body, wherein, the upper side and lower side of the plate body are provided with a sealing pad separately, an anode tablet is arranged above the sealing pad of the upper side of the plate body, the anode tablet, sealing pad and the plate body are connected with each other through two rivets, a nickel connection sheet and an aluminum tag are arranged separately at the upper end and lower end of each of the rivets. The utility model is capable of improving the large current amplifying performance of the battery; replacing the welding way with the riveting connection way, the nickel connection sheet is connected to the anode tablet, which eliminates the inner resistance of the welding point and prevents the reduction of the tightness of the battery caused by spot-welding the nickel connection sheet at the same time.
Description
Technical field
The utility model relates to a kind of lithium ion battery, relates in particular to a kind of cover board arrangement of lithium ion battery.
Background technology
At present, most lithium ion battery cover board, be to link to each other with the volume core of inside battery by a single aluminium strip that is riveted on the cover plate compressing tablet, and by on the cover plate compressing tablet spot welding nickel strap link to each other with external circuit, battery is when high-multiplying power discharge like this, electric current by aluminium strip can not be excessive, otherwise aluminium strip will generate heat, even fusing; And because on the cover board the spot welding nickel strap can cause this solder joint place internal resistance bigger than normal, battery should generate heat at the place when heavy-current discharge, melts the beneath sealing gasket of anodal compressing tablet, thereby causes battery sealing-performance to descend; Simultaneously, when spot welding nickel strap on anodal compressing tablet, the vibrations of welding machine can cause the reduction of anodal compressing tablet and cover plate riveting intensity, thereby cause anodal compressing tablet loosening, and the sealing of battery descends.
Summary of the invention
The purpose of this utility model provides a kind of lithium ion battery cover board, and this cover plate not only has the function of common cover, and can effectively improve the battery high-rate discharge capacity, and battery has good sealing characteristics in processing, use simultaneously.

The beneficial effects of the utility model are: lithium ion battery cover board described in the utility model is owing to adopted two discharge circuits, battery is when high-multiplying power discharge, current ratio by aluminium pole ears is less, the heat that aluminium pole ears sends is fewer, be difficult for fusing, simultaneously since the nickel brace by the rivet rivet clasp on plate body, eliminated that the place's internal resistance of spot-welding technology solder joint is bigger than normal, the shortcoming of easy heating, therefore can be with the sealing gasket fusing of anodal compressing tablet below, thus the sealing of battery guaranteed.
